Output 58285e7a7574f55a92defc250b81c333af2440647caf14ec04bb33c3d05b9b21:0

value
3319248
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bb749f48f99719ec5e7022f1c77d7d19083f6db OP_EQUALVERIFY OP_CHECKSIG
address
17uMFXJcotammg9KAULYnvr5zWBC1N3zgq
transaction
58285e7a7574f55a92defc250b81c333af2440647caf14ec04bb33c3d05b9b21
spent
true